This Museum has on permanent display an authenic Confederate battle flag, a large collection of weapons and equipment, period photographs and other artifacts. They have a wide acclaim for anextensive collection of period clothing from the 19th and early 20th centuries. Many prominent families from the area have donated exquisite items of attire from bygone years, which textile experts have carefully reworked and preserved. Select exhibits from this vast collection are mounted throughout the year. Story boards identify the origin, fabric, style and donor of the article.IOt real intresting for everyone. Guided tours of museum and/or local architecture arranged by appointment. Handicapped Access
